What are the Advantages of Truck Tuning?
Whether the ECU is replaced, the engine is remapped, or a performance chip is installed, the software change can have a significant impact on how your vehicle operates. Let’s take a look at some of the main advantages.
Who wouldn’t want more horsepower in their truck? You can increase the horsepower output of your vehicle’s engine by tuning it. When the ECU is first installed, it has conservative software settings, including power settings. These make the truck more stable in a variety of conditions, but they also mean that some power is lost. Chip tuning can alter the fuel/air ratio and timing to increase the power and torque of your truck. An engine remap on your truck will give you up to 20% more brake horsepower (BHP) & torque which improves fuel economy by around 8-15% depending on the model of truck. This will save your company a fortune in fuel!
An engine tune will also improve fuel efficiency. The right truck tuning can make a significant difference in your fuel economy. An engine tune designed to increase fuel efficiency will frequently reduce horsepower. It is critical to decide what you want from your engine and how you will drive the vehicle.
Which Trucks Are Best for Tuning?
The majority of the trucks share the same engine, diesel pumps and injectors, and turbo. As a result, most late-model diesel trucks, including Mercedes, Volvo, Renault, Nissan, Isuzu, IVECO, Fuso, Scania, and many others, can benefit from Truck Tuning.
